Why the space under an appliance deserves a plan

The floor beneath an appliance is part of the home’s moisture and maintenance system. A small leak can remain hidden under a washer. A refrigerator can leave dust around the condenser area or retain food residue after a spill. When the appliance never moves, the homeowner may notice a smell or swollen flooring before noticing the source.

Moving a heavy appliance is not automatically safer than leaving it in place. The appliance may be connected to electricity, water, a drain, a gas supply, an ice-maker line, or a flexible hose. A door, drawer, leveling foot, or anti-tip feature may change the balance as it moves. The right goal is controlled access for inspection and cleaning, not maximum travel distance.

Use a written plan with three boundaries: what the appliance manual permits, what the room connections allow, and what the floor can safely support. If any boundary is unclear, stop and ask the appliance manufacturer or a qualified installer. A mobile base can make a compatible appliance easier to pull straight out, but it does not remove the need to disconnect or protect services.

Signs that cleaning should not wait

  • Water, detergent residue, rust marks, or a musty smell near the appliance.
  • Visible lint, pet hair, dust, or food debris along the front edge or side gaps.
  • Floorboards, laminate, or cabinet panels that look swollen, soft, stained, or discolored.
  • A washer that vibrates differently, a drain hose that shifts, or a refrigerator that no longer sits level.
  • Unusual heat, noise, odor, or a change in cooling or washing performance.

Read the appliance instructions before moving it

The appliance manual is the first source for clearances, leveling, service access, power requirements, water connections, and transport instructions. Some appliances are intended to slide forward on their own feet. Others require special handling, a second person, a service technician, or a manufacturer-approved transport method.

Do not assume that a mobile base is universally compatible because the frame appears wide enough. The appliance’s weight distribution, compressor position, drum movement, feet, vibration behavior, door swing, and required ventilation all matter. Confirm that the appliance maker permits the use of a third-party base and that the final height does not block a vent, drain, countertop, or door.

Check whether the refrigerator has an ice-maker line, water dispenser line, or floor-level anti-tip bracket. Check whether the washer has hot and cold supply hoses, a drain hose, a power cord, and a transport or leveling requirement. A dryer may have an exhaust duct or gas connection that must not be stretched or crushed. A base can improve access while still being the wrong choice for a particular installation.

When to stop and call for help

  • The appliance is gas-powered or connected to a gas line.
  • The power cord, water line, drain hose, or exhaust duct is too short to allow safe movement.
  • The appliance is built in, anchored, stacked, or secured with a bracket that you cannot identify.
  • The floor is damaged, wet, uneven, or too weak to support the appliance during movement.
  • You cannot move the appliance without tipping it, lifting it, or placing hands near a crush point.

Prepare the room and the appliance

Clear the full route before you touch the appliance. Remove baskets, mats, stools, pet bowls, and anything that can catch a wheel or foot. Open doors and drawers that could collide with the appliance. Protect a fragile floor with a suitable moving surface only when the appliance maker and the floor manufacturer permit it. A cloth towel alone can bunch up and create a trip or sliding hazard.

For a refrigerator, move perishable food only if the doors must remain open for a prolonged period or the power will be interrupted. Keep food cold in a cooler with a cold source when necessary. The USDA Food Safety and Inspection Service advises keeping a refrigerator at 40°F or below and minimizing unnecessary door opening. Cleaning the floor should not create a food-temperature problem.

For a washer, finish the cycle, turn off the water supply valves, and follow the manual’s shutdown steps. Do not pull on hoses or the power cord. If a drain hose is inserted into a standpipe, confirm that it has enough slack and remains correctly positioned. A small movement can turn a stable drain connection into a leak.

Take photographs of the connections before moving anything. Mark the original front edge and leveling position with removable tape. These reference points make it easier to return the appliance to its original position and notice if a foot, hose, or bracket has shifted.

Measure the route, not only the appliance

Measure the open width between cabinets, the clear depth available behind the appliance, the height under counters, and the turning space at the end of the route. A base that fits under the appliance may still make the total height too high or the total width too wide for the opening.

Measure the appliance footprint at its widest and deepest points. Include door handles, hoses, cords, drain connections, rear covers, and any anti-tip hardware. If the appliance will move only 12 inches for cleaning, confirm that the first 12 inches are free of floor transitions, cabinet lips, and service loops.

Check What to measure or observe Why it matters
Appliance footprint Width, depth, weight distribution, and contact points. The support frame must carry the appliance without overhang or rocking.
Opening Cabinet width, counter height, door swing, and side clearances. The appliance must pass through the opening without scraping or binding.
Service slack Power cord, water hoses, drain hose, ice-maker line, and exhaust path. Connections must not be stretched, kinked, crushed, or pulled loose.
Floor route Grout, thresholds, soft spots, mats, slopes, and surface finish. Wheels and feet behave differently on hard, uneven, or delicate surfaces.
Return position Original leveling marks, vent clearances, and door alignment. The appliance must go back to a stable, functional position after cleaning.

Write the smallest usable dimension rather than the largest empty-looking dimension. If the route is close, make a cardboard outline of the base and appliance footprint. Test the outline through the opening before assembling or loading a heavy appliance.

Assemble and inspect the empty base

Build the base on a clear floor before placing an appliance on it. Follow the current assembly instructions and identify every corner, rail, pad, caster, and locking mechanism. Confirm that parts seat fully and that no connector is cracked, loose, or installed backward.

Set the empty frame to the planned width, then measure it again. The four corners should form a stable rectangle or square rather than a skewed parallelogram. Check that all support pads sit at the same height and that the casters point in the direction of intended travel. Do not assume that a caster that swivels visually is designed to swivel in use; the listing specifically describes straight-line movement.

Push the empty base a short distance on the actual floor. Watch for catching, twisting, sudden stops, and marks. Test the locks while the base is empty. A lock that is difficult to engage now will be harder to use after an appliance is loaded.

Do not place an appliance on a frame that rocks, flexes unexpectedly, or has a corner that lifts from the floor. Correct the assembly or stop the project. Never use folded cardboard, loose wood blocks, or improvised shims beneath a caster to compensate for an uneven floor.

Load the appliance with controlled movement

Loading a refrigerator or washer onto a base is the highest-risk part of the project. Use the number of people and lifting method specified by the appliance manufacturer. Keep hands out of pinch points. Do not try to lift a full refrigerator alone or tip a washer across a connected hose.

Center the appliance on the support area and keep its feet or approved contact points within the frame. The frame should not support only one side or a small corner. If the appliance has adjustable feet, do not remove or ignore them without understanding how leveling and vibration control work.

Before movement, confirm that cords and hoses have a smooth service loop. Move slowly in a straight line. One person should guide the appliance and another should watch the rear connections, floor route, and side clearances. Stop immediately if a hose bends sharply, a cord drags, a cabinet catches, or the appliance begins to lean.

Move only as far as necessary

For floor cleaning, the safest movement is usually the shortest movement that exposes the dirty area. Pulling an appliance completely into the room creates more route, more connection slack, and more opportunity for a tip or impact. Plan the cleaning zone before moving so you know when to stop.

Keep the base aligned with the original travel direction. Because the W618-1 listing describes straight-line casters, do not pivot the loaded appliance sideways as if it were a shopping cart. Turning can load one corner unevenly, twist the frame, or push the appliance into a cabinet.

Engage the locks before cleaning under or around the appliance. Test that the appliance remains stationary with a light, controlled push. A lock is not proof that the frame is level or that the floor can carry the load. If the appliance moves while you clean, stop and correct the setup.

Clean the floor and the appliance area

Start with dry debris. Vacuum dust, lint, hair, and crumbs using a narrow attachment rather than sweeping debris deeper under the appliance. Keep the vacuum body and cord clear of the travel route. Do not spray liquid beneath an energized appliance or allow a wet cloth to contact electrical parts.

For a refrigerator, clean the floor with a mild method appropriate for the surface. The USDA Food Safety and Inspection Service recommends wiping refrigerator spills promptly and cleaning surfaces with hot, soapy water before rinsing. That guidance applies to food-contact surfaces inside the refrigerator; for the floor, follow the flooring manufacturer’s care instructions and avoid excess water near the appliance.

Inspect the rear and side areas while they are visible. Look for water trails, rust, insect activity, damaged insulation, crushed cords, kinked hoses, and dust accumulation near ventilation openings. Do not remove panels or reach into a compressor or electrical compartment unless the manual specifically allows it and power is safely isolated.

Allow the cleaned floor to dry before returning the appliance. Wet flooring beneath a heavy machine can increase slipping and moisture damage. A cleaning product that leaves a slippery film is not a successful cleaning product for an appliance route.

Do not use these shortcuts

  • Do not flood the floor to loosen dirt under a refrigerator or washer.
  • Do not use a steam cleaner near exposed cords, outlets, hoses, or control components.
  • Do not scrape flooring with metal tools or drag the appliance across a wet surface.
  • Do not place a loose board, towel, or block beneath a loaded caster to change its height.
  • Do not spray disinfectant where residue could contact food, seals, hoses, or flooring finishes.

Return a refrigerator to a safe operating position

Before returning a refrigerator, check the appliance manual for rear and side clearances, leveling, door alignment, and ventilation. The USDA notes that the condenser area and front grille should remain free of dust and lint to permit airflow. Do not push the refrigerator so close to a wall that the required airflow is lost.

Check that doors close and seal normally. A refrigerator that sits too far forward, too high, or at the wrong angle may cause a door to remain open or a water line to pull tight. If the appliance has a water dispenser or ice maker, inspect the line for kinks and leaks after the move.

Restore food only after the refrigerator is stable and powered according to the manual. Keep the doors closed while the interior returns to its operating temperature. Use an appliance thermometer when food safety is in doubt; the USDA recommends maintaining a refrigerator at 40°F or below.

Return a washer without creating a leak or vibration problem

Reconnect or inspect water supply hoses exactly as the washer manual directs. Confirm that shutoff valves are accessible, hoses are not rubbing against the base, and the drain hose remains secured at the correct height. A washer can look correctly positioned while its drain connection is already under stress.

Run a short supervised fill, drain, and spin test after the appliance is returned. Look and listen for leaks, unusual movement, banging, hose contact, or a change in floor vibration. Stop the cycle if the machine walks, rocks, or pulls against a connection.

Do not assume that a mobile base eliminates the need for washer leveling. The base, floor, appliance feet, and load distribution all affect stability. If the washer manual requires direct floor contact or a specific pedestal, follow that requirement instead of relying on the accessory listing.

Compare a mobile base with other cleaning approaches

A mobile base is useful only when the appliance and room support it. In many homes, a long vacuum attachment or a slim cleaning tool can reach the front and sides without moving the appliance. A service technician may be the better option when connections are short or the floor is fragile.

Approach Best use Limit to recognize
Vacuum and slim tool Light dust and hair near the front or side gaps. May not reach spills or damage hidden behind the appliance.
Qualified appliance service Short connections, built-in units, leaks, or uncertain installation. Requires scheduling and may cost more than routine cleaning.
Manufacturer-approved pedestal When the appliance maker specifies a compatible raised base. May be fixed in place and not designed for movement.
Adjustable mobile base A compatible floor-standing appliance that needs occasional straight-line access. Requires fit checks, stable locking, service slack, and a suitable floor.

The most convenient option is not always the safest. Choose the method that preserves the appliance manufacturer’s installation conditions and makes future cleaning realistic. If the moving method is too complex to repeat, the floor will eventually go uncleaned again.

Common mistakes that damage floors or connections

Moving before measuring

Without a route measurement, a homeowner may discover a cabinet lip, island, doorway, or threshold only after the appliance is already moving. The resulting stop can twist the base or leave the appliance partly supported.

Trusting the maximum load number alone

A merchant-published 400 kg claim does not prove that every appliance, floor, caster, or installation is safe. Confirm the appliance weight, center of gravity, support points, frame width, and manual requirements.

Turning a straight-line base

The current W618-1 listing describes straight-line casters. Pivoting a loaded base can apply side loads that the product was not designed to manage. Return to the original direction before moving and stop when alignment is lost.

Cleaning while the appliance is unsecured

A locked caster helps keep the base stationary, but it does not fix a warped floor or a rocking frame. Test stability before kneeling or reaching underneath. Keep children and pets away from the work area.

Leaving the appliance unlevel

Refrigerator doors, washer drums, water flow, and vibration can all be affected by a changed position. Use the appliance’s own leveling procedure after cleaning and perform a supervised test.

Maintenance schedule after installation

A mobile base creates value only when it makes maintenance easier. Do not wait for a leak or performance change. Add a recurring inspection to the household calendar and keep the cleaning tools close enough that the job is practical.

  • Monthly: vacuum visible dust and check the front edge, side gaps, cords, hoses, and floor condition.
  • Quarterly: inspect the base frame, caster locks, corner pads, connectors, and appliance alignment.
  • After a spill or leak: stop using the appliance if necessary, isolate the source, dry the floor, and repair the connection before moving again.
  • After any relocation: repeat the level, clearance, door, hose, drain, and supervised-operation checks.
  • Before deep cleaning: review the current appliance and base instructions rather than relying on an old installation memory.

Frequently asked questions

Can I use a mobile base under any refrigerator?

No. Compatibility depends on the refrigerator’s weight distribution, footprint, leveling system, water line, anti-tip hardware, ventilation, and manufacturer instructions. The W618-1 listing shows refrigerator and laundry applications, but that does not establish universal compatibility.

How far should I move an appliance to clean underneath?

Move it only far enough to expose the required cleaning and inspection area. A shorter straight-line movement reduces stress on cords, hoses, floors, and cabinets. If the required distance is not possible without disconnecting or tipping the appliance, use qualified service.

Can I clean under the refrigerator with a steam cleaner?

Do not assume so. Steam and liquid can reach electrical parts, flooring joints, cords, and appliance components. Use a dry vacuum first and follow the floor and appliance manufacturers’ cleaning instructions.

Should I unplug a refrigerator before moving it?

Follow the refrigerator manual and the exact cleaning procedure. If power must be disconnected, protect the food and allow the unit to return to the required temperature before relying on the stored food. Never pull the plug by the cord or move a powered appliance across a wet floor.

How often should I clean under a large appliance?

Inspect monthly and perform a deeper clean at least seasonally, adjusting for pets, lint, cooking spills, humidity, and the appliance location. Clean immediately after any leak, overflow, or spill.
